The world of free romance literature is a treasure trove just waiting to be explored! One of the most accessible formats is definitely eBooks. You can find a vast array on platforms like Project Gutenberg or Smashwords. ePub and PDF formats are particularly popular because they’re compatible with most devices, whether you're reading on a Kindle or an app on your phone. ePub offers that flexible layout that adjusts to different screen sizes, making it super easy to read anywhere. Finding free downloads for romance books can be quite an adventure, especially if you're open to various formats and platforms. E-books reign supreme, and if you're looking for something to read on the go, you can't go wrong with formats like EPUB and MOBI. Many libraries and sites like Project Gutenberg offer a plethora of classic romance novels in these formats, letting you hop on your e-reader or tablet and dive right into a world of swoon-worthy moments. Also, don't overlook PDF downloads, which are super handy for reading on computers or tablets—just grab that romantic gem and open it up wherever you are!
If you’re into audiobooks, that’s another fantastic option. Some platforms like Librivox offer free audiobooks of public domain romance titles. I can confirm that the Bible is indeed available online for free in PDF format. Many websites offer downloadable versions, including popular platforms like Bible Gateway and Project Gutenberg. These sites provide various translations, from the classic King James Version to modern interpretations like the New International Version.
Finding a PDF is straightforward—just search for 'free Bible PDF' and you'll see multiple options. Some sites even offer study guides or annotated versions alongside the text. If you're looking for a specific translation, it's worth checking the official websites of religious organizations, as they often provide free downloads. Digital Bibles are convenient for on-the-go reading, and the PDF format ensures compatibility with most devices.

There’s something special about reading classics like 'Pride and Prejudice', especially when you can access them for free online! Various platforms let you dive into Elizabeth Bennet's world without spending a dime. Project Gutenberg is a fantastic resource, offering this literary gem in multiple formats. You can choose from plain text, ePub, or Kindle formats, making it super easy to read on your favorite device, whether it's an e-reader, tablet, or even your computer. The beauty of having different formats is that it caters to all kinds of readers, no matter your preference!
Another great site is Internet Archive. They not only have 'Pride and Prejudice' in digital format but also a plethora of editions, including some with beautiful illustrations. They even have a lending library service where you can borrow a digital version of a physical book for a period of time. It’s like having a local library right on your screen! If you enjoy the audio experience, check out LibriVox. They offer free audiobooks read by volunteers.
